Natural Resources: Vexillum Minerals and Mangena Metals

Natural resources and mineral development represent the core of Mangena Group’s investment thesis, and two portfolio companies give that thesis operational form. Vexillum Minerals is the group’s dedicated natural resources platform focused on mining projects and mineral development across Africa and the Americas, working with technical operators to develop projects in precious metals, strategic minerals, and commodity trading.

Mangena Metals operates at the financial and trading layer of the precious metals market, participating in metals trading and commodity transactions that complement the group’s upstream mineral development activities. Together, these two businesses give Mangena Group exposure to natural resources across the full value chain, from in-ground asset development through to market-facing commodity trading.

Energy: MNGN Oil & Gas and Mangena Motor Fuels

Energy investment is the second primary pillar of Mangena Group’s strategy, and two portfolio companies reflect the group’s activity across the energy value chain. MNGN Oil & Gas focuses on energy production and development, working with operators in upstream oil and gas markets to identify and advance producing and near-production assets. Mangena Motor Fuels operates at the distribution and trading layer, providing fuel distribution and oil trading services that connect energy production to end markets.

The combination of upstream development through MNGN Oil & Gas and downstream distribution through Mangena Motor Fuels reflects the group’s deliberate approach to building complementary positions across related investment areas, reducing exposure to any single point in the value chain while maintaining meaningful participation in the overall economics of the energy sector.

Agriculture and Food Systems: Mangena AgriTec and Mangena General Trading

Agriculture represents one of Mangena Group’s most distinctive investment areas combining the structural demand story of global food security with the operational opportunities of emerging market agricultural development. Mangena AgriTec is the group’s dedicated agricultural technology and food production platform, with activities spanning agricultural land investments, livestock production, aquaculture, aquaponics, and hydroponic farming systems.

Mangena General Trading supports the agricultural and commodity supply chain a global trading platform that connects agricultural production to distribution channels across international markets. The combination of Mangena AgriTec’s production focus and Mangena General Trading’s commercial activities creates an integrated agricultural platform that is more resilient and more commercially dynamic than either company could be independently.

Infrastructure: MHE Global and RMS Logistics

Infrastructure investment sits at the foundation of the group’s broader portfolio, the assets and businesses that support global trade, industrial development, and the logistical requirements of the group’s natural resources and energy activities. MHE Global is a heavy machinery leasing platform, providing the equipment that infrastructure and industrial projects require at every stage of development. RMS Logistics provides supply chain and logistics solutions that support global trade operations.

These two businesses reflect the group’s understanding that infrastructure investment is most valuable when it serves a genuine operational need within a broader industrial ecosystem and that the most defensible infrastructure positions are those that serve essential functions at scale.

Strategic and Specialty: Infinity Jet Card, Vertex Citizenship Services, and Mangena Media

Three additional portfolio companies reflect the breadth of Mangena Group’s investment platform beyond its core resource and infrastructure sectors. Infinity Jet Card is a private aviation membership platform providing flexible, high-quality air travel access for business clients operating across the group’s global network. Vertex Citizenship Services provides global mobility and citizenship solutions, an increasingly important service for high-net-worth individuals and international businesses navigating a world where geographic flexibility has significant practical and financial value.

Mangena Media rounds out the portfolio as a media and documentary production platform reflecting the group’s commitment to communication, storytelling, and the responsible communication of its investment activities and the communities it works in. Each of these businesses adds a layer of strategic value to the overall platform that goes beyond simple portfolio diversification.
